Philip Haythornthwaite

Philip J. Haythornthwaite FRHistS (born 1951) is an author and historical consultant specialising in military history, uniforms, and equipment.

Since 1973, Haythornthwaite has had over 80 books published, in addition to numerous articles and papers on military history.

Haythornthwaite is a Fellow of the Royal Historical Society and a Member of the British Commission for Military History.

[2][3] In 2015 he was awarded a Certificate in Recognition of Lifetime Achievement jointly by the BCMH and the Peninsular War 200 organisation.
